The facilities at Oxenholme Lake District are designed to cater to a wide range of passenger needs. With a fully operational ticket office open from early morning until late evening throughout the week, travelers can purchase and collect tickets with ease. The station is equipped with ticket machines, including accessible options for those with specific needs. For online ticket collectors, the convenience doesn't stop there – tickets bought online can be easily retrieved from the ticket machines.
Oxenholme Lake District ensures accessibility for all passengers, offering step-free access predominantly throughout the station. While the access to Platforms 2 and 3 includes a steep ramp, helpful staff assistance is available during generous service hours every day. This accessibility commitment is further supported by facilities like heated waiting rooms and accessible toilets, providing comfort and convenience for every traveler.
For those planning a longer stay, Avanti West Coast operates a 24-hour car park, with spaces available for both daily and long-term use. As well as traditional refreshment options at Café Express on Platforms 2 and 3, shops are available, adding a touch of convenience before your journey continues.

Travelers at Redhill station will find a wide array of amenities to cater to their needs. Ticket purchasing, for instance, is a breeze with a ticket office open from early morning until late in the evening. There are also accessible ticket machines for those with disabilities and these machines are capable of processing tickets with Disabled Persons Railcard discounts. Additionally, smartcard facilities are available for seamless travel with modern technology.
Accessibility within the station is a priority. Step-free access is available throughout, ensuring everyone can reach their desired platform easily. Although the station lacks tactile surfaces along all platform edges, assistance can be arranged at the help point located by the Ticket Office.
When it comes to comfort, Redhill station provides seating in lieu of a formal waiting room, but you're never far from refreshments since there are drinking facilities available. Keep in mind that there are no shops within the station, so plan ahead if you need to grab any essentials. For ticket collection and general inquiries, there's assistance available, ensuring all passengers can travel with peace of mind.
Redhill station is well-connected to various modes of transport, making onward travel convenient. A taxi rank situated right outside the main entrance provides a quick getaway, while local bus services offer alternate public transport options for those looking to explore or reach their final destination.
If your journey involves a transfer or a missed connection, a rail replacement service might be necessary on occasions of service disruption. It's advisable to check the station for real-time updates or inquire at the help point.
